Something I've always wanted to do....by Deborah Nell


For the longest time I've desired to paint live during the worship time at church on Sundays. I've seen others do it and knew in my heart that I was to do this also. Two weeks ago I painted during the worship service at our church, Harvest Chapel. I was nervous, excited and couldn't believe I was actually going to do it. Could I create while everyone was there... praising God? Could I focus?  Well, the experience was amazing. The time went by quickly and I became swept up in the process. Afterwards, a woman came up to me in tears and told me how the painting had moved her.  The second time I painted live, was also good. It was not as amazing for me, but very glad I did it. This is a process of learning and discovering how to paint as though no one is looking. It's fast and furious at times. I'm so glad I've begun this journey. I know I have lots to learn.
